Ion current rectification properties of non-Newtonian fluids in conical nanochannels
Lei Tang, Hao Yu, Peng Li, Runxin Liu, Yi Zhou, Jie Li
Abstract
In this study, the ICR properties of non-Newtonian fluids in conical nanochannels are investigated. The results show that both increasing and decreasing power-law index n (with respect to n = 1) have an inhibitory effect on ICR.
